| So I'm out at a jetty this morning trying to locate some bait. I spot a small group of mullet and I think I'm in business.. I toss out the net and feel like I just snagged on a rock. I pull the rope back and see a giant silver mirror thrashing back. I quickly pull it on the rocks and see it a 4' Tarpon. After he sufficiently shredded my cast net I gently remove him and place him back in the water and he swims away. So now I have a broken net, no live bait and a story to tell. |
